    Configuring Go Modules

    Configuring Go modules is essential for managing dependencies effectively. He should initiate a module by running “go mod init” in his project directory. This command creates a go.mod file, which tracks dependencies. Accurate tracking is crucial for financial applications. He can then append dependencies using “go get.” This simplifies version control. Understanding module versions helps mitigate risks. Risk management is vital in finance.

    Writing Unit Tests in Go

    Writing unit tests in Go involves creating functions that validate specific behaviors of code. He should use the “testing” package to facilitate this process. Each test function must start with “Test” followed by a descriptive name. Descriptive names enhance clarity. He can utilize assertions to compare expected and actual outcomes. Comparisons are crucial for identifying discrepancies. Running tests regularly helps maintain code quality. Quality is essential for reliability.

    Using Go’s Testing Package

    Using Go’s testing package is essential for effective software validation. He can create test files that end with “_test.go” to organize tests. This organization enhances clarity and structure. The testing package provides functions like “t.Error” and “t.Fail” for reporting failures. Reporting failures is crucial for accountability. He can run tests using the “go test” command, which executes all tests in the package. Execution ensures comprehensive coverage. Regular testing helps maintain high-quality code. Quality is non-negotiable in finance.

    Managing External Dependencies

    Managing external dependencies is crucial for maintaining application stability. He should regularly review the go.mod file to track all dependencies. Tracking ensures compatibility and reduces conflicts. He can use “go mod tidy” to remove unused dependencies. This cleanup minimizes clutter. Additionally, he should specify version constraints to avoid breaking changes. Avoiding breaks is essential for reliability. Regular updates help mitigate security vulnerabilities. Security is paramount in finance.

    Using the Go Profiler

    Using the Go profiler allows for in-depth performance analysis. He can start profiling by importing the net/http/pprof package in his application. This import enables runtime profiling of CPU and memory. Profiling helps identify resource-intensive functions. Identifying functions is crucial for optimization. He can access profiling data via a web interface. The interface provides visual insights into performance metrics. Regularly analyzing this data leads to informed decisions. Informed decisions enhance application efficiency.
